    Ben Walmsley said 2 years, 10 months ago:

    Got the decals on. They went down very nicely but I’m thinking that the surface detail on these eduard kits really deserves to be masked and painted. Nevertheless, we’ll see how it comes up after a wash. I also added a little light exhaust staining with an airbrush. Not gonna go too heavy with the weathering on this one. Fiddly bits are ready to go too.
